Popular Types of Home Additions
There are many ways to expand a house based on the homeowner’s needs. Room additions are one of the most common options because they provide flexible extra space. Families often use them as bedrooms, playrooms, or entertainment areas.
Kitchen expansions are also popular. A larger kitchen improves movement, storage, and cooking space. Bathroom additions can also increase convenience, especially for larger families.
Some homeowners choose second-story additions when there is limited yard space. Others build sunrooms or enclosed patios to create comfortable indoor-outdoor living areas. The right choice depends on the home layout and long-term goals.
Understanding the Construction Process
The construction process usually begins with design and permit approvals. Once permits are approved, contractors prepare the site and begin structural work. This phase may include framing, roofing, electrical work, and plumbing installation.
After the structure is complete, workers install flooring, paint walls, and finish interior details. Final inspections ensure the addition meets safety and quality standards. Good project management helps keep everything on schedule.

Avoiding Common Remodeling Mistakes
Many homeowners rush into projects without proper planning. This can lead to budget problems, delays, and design issues. One common mistake is choosing contractors based only on low pricing instead of experience and reputation.
Another mistake is ignoring permits and inspections. Construction work must follow local regulations to ensure safety and legal compliance. Poor planning can also create layout problems that reduce the usefulness of the new space.
Homeowners should also avoid changing plans too often during construction. Frequent changes can increase costs and extend project timelines. A clear plan from the beginning usually leads to better results.
